Davao Medical School Foundation is a pioneer and the leading medical college in Davao City, Mindanao, Philippines, established in the year 1976. Known for the top quality medical education it imparts, Davao Medical School Foundation has become a favourite choice for International students, especially from India. The college is located in a tranquil yet dynamic city, Davao, providing the best environment for studying medicine in a conducive atmosphere, with more than 125 outstanding and experienced faculty members renowned in their respective fields. Currently, the college houses more than 1,500 international students from various countries around the world, making the campus a diverse, inclusive and welcoming learning place. NMC insists on at least a course duration of 4.5 years, but DMSF runs a full-time program for about 5.5 years.
The entire program is based on the medium of Instruction as laid down by NMC, meaning everything throughout the course is conducted in the English language.
All required subjects from the NMC-prescribed list are covered within the curriculum during the course duration.
The MBBS degree of Davao Medical School Foundation is approved by the Commission on Higher Education (CHED) of the Philippines and also by other nations across.
A 12-month-long internship is compulsory to obtain practical clinical experience and get hands-on experience with patient care.
Students need to clear FMGE/NExT and have to complete 1 year of internship in India before becoming capable of practising medicine.

The curriculum at DMSF is structured as 16 months of pre-medical training, then a highly selective 4-year MD program covering the basic science, paraclinical and clinical sciences, concluding in a compulsory 1-year clinical clerkship. Pre-Medical (BS) Years

By land area, Davao City is the largest city in the Philippines and the premier economic hub of Mindanao. Known as one of the safest cities in the Philippines, it boasts abundant biodiversity, a low crime rate and cultural diversity, a city where one can explore both natural wonders and economic opportunity in the region.

The climate in Davao City is a Tropical Rainforest climate characterised by consistently warm temperatures all year round, with no noticeable changes during different seasons. The city is also blessed with constant rainfall, and high humidity levels are prevalent, all contributing to stable, green and lush conditions.
March to May Summer in Davao is hot, humid, and tropical, with temperatures averaging at 30°C and with sun and occasional showers throughout. Davao Medical School Foundation Graduates can find jobs in India, the Philippines, the USA and other countries. They can practice in various specialisation areas or have a career in academia as a faculty member or research associate. To find work in various other countries, students are required to obtain a license by qualifying for the country-specific licensing exams.
Graduates can practice medicine in India after clearing the FMGE/NExT.
